Cabinet approves the establishment of the National Anti-profiteering Authority under GST

Union Cabinet has given its approval for the creation of the posts of Chairman and Technical Members of the National Anti-profiteering Authority (NAA) under Goods and Services Tax.

  • NAA has been set up to ensure that the benefits of the reduction in GST rates are passed on to the end consumers by reduction in prices.
  • NAA is a part of an institutional framework to implement “anti-profiteering” measures under GST regime.
  • Along with NAA, this framework comprises a Standing Committee, Screening Committees in every State and the Directorate General of Safeguards in the Central Board of Excise & Customs (CBEC).

Cabinet approves agreement between India and Belarus on Scientific and Technological Cooperation

Union Cabinet has been apprised of the agreement between the Indian National Science Academy (INSA) and the National Academy of Sciences of Belarus (NASB) on Scientific and Technological Cooperation for mutual benefit in the areas of science, technology, agriculture, etc.

  • This agreement was exchanged on September 12, 2017 at New Delhi during the visit of Belarus President H.E. Mr. Alexander Lukashenko.
  • Objective of this MoU is to identify, assess, develop and commercialize globally competitive technologies from India and Belarus.
  • Technology transfers, exchange of visits and joint workshops for scientific and economic benefit have also been included in the scope of this MoU.

Objective of this MoU is to recognize the mutual benefit of cooperation in the field of Civil Aviation with a special emphasis on improving Regional Air Connectivity in India.

  • Term of the MoU is 5 years.
  • The MoU seeks to address any legal and procedural issues in civil aviation sector which may negatively affect cooperation between the two countries.
  • Flight simulators monitoring and approvals, maintenance personnel approvals, aircraft maintenance facilities approvals and aircrew members approvals have also been included in the scope of this MoU

Cabinet approves Continuation of sub-schemes under Umbrella Scheme “Integrated Child Development Services (ICDS)”

The sub-schemes that will be continued are Anganwadi Services, Scheme for Adolescent Girls, Child Protection Services and National Crèche Scheme.

  • Besides, cabinet has also approved conversion of National Crèche Scheme from Central Sector to Centrally Sponsored Scheme. This scheme aims to provide a safe place for mothers to leave their children while they are at work.
  • These sub-schemes will be continued till November 30, 2018 with financial outlay of over Rs.41000 crore.
  • Above mentioned sub-schemes are continuing from the 12th Five Year Plan. However, Government has rationalised these sub-schemes in financial year 2016-17 and have been brought under Umbrella ICDS as its sub-schemes.
  • It is expected that around 11 crore children, pregnant women & Lactating Mothers and the Adolescent Girls will gain benefits through these schemes.

Cabinet okays increase in carpet area of houses under PMAY

Approval for increase in the carpet area has been provided for those houses that are eligible for interest subsidy under the Credit Linked Subsidy Scheme (CLSS) for the Middle Income Group (MIG) under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(Urban).

  • As per this approval, carpet area in the MIG I category of CLSS has been increased from the existing 90 square metre to up to 120 square metre.
  • For MIG II category of CLSS, the carpet area has been increased from the existing 110 square metre to up to 150 square metre.
  • These changes have made effective from January 1, 2017.

About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(PMAY)

  •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ana – Urban (PMAY – U)scheme launched in June 2015 by PM Modi has a vision to provide Housing For All by year 2022, which coincides with 75 years of Indian independence.
  • It is geared towards fulfilling housing requirements of urban poor including slum dwellers.
  • It is administered by Union Ministry of Housing and Urban Poverty Alleviation.

Cabinet allows export of all varieties of pulses

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s has given its approval for removal of prohibition on export of all types of pulses.

Expected benefits from allowing export of all varieties of pulses:

  • This decision has been taken to ensure that farmers have more choices in marketing their produce and in getting better prices for their produce.
  • Farmers will now be encouraged to expand the area of sowing pulses.
  • Opening up of export market would provide an alternative avenue to ship out surplus production of pulses.
  • Besides, this will help Indian exporters to regain their lost market share, which will eventually benefit the country in terms of increased foreign exchange income.
